Verdict

Passing Call has a high cruising speed and may have more to offer now she has discovered the winning habit but RED TORNADO appeals as being better handicapped having capitalised on a good mark last time and being suited to quick tracks such as this. Bleu Et Noir is fit from the Flat, has C&D winning form and on a good mark if anywhere near his 2016 performance levels.
